Ethanolic Extract of Butea monosperma Leaves Elevate Blood Insulin Level in Type 2 Diabetic Rats, Stimulate Insulin Secretion in Isolated Rat Islets, and Enhance Hepatic Glycogen Formation

Table 1

Effect of ethanolic extract of BM on insulin secretion from isolated rat islets.

GroupInsulin secretion (ng/mg islet protein)
Glucose: 3 mMGlucose: 11 mM

Control2.99 (2.65–4.27)5.41 (4.91–9.27)*
BM 20 μg/mL2.65 (2.23–3.71)5.19 (4.41–8.72)
BM 40 μg/mL3.45 (2.67–3.99)5.31 (4.18–7.67)
BM 80 μg/mL5.28 (3.87–6.09)*7.84 (6.98–9.54)*
Glibenclamide (10 μg/L)5.89 (4.34–6.95)*8.92 (7.67–9.86)*

Isolated rat islets were incubated for 60 min with ethanol extract BM (10, 20, and 30 mg/mL) in the presence of 3 or 11 mM glucose. Data are presented as median (range), n = 5. Mann-Whitney U-test was used to evaluate statistical significance. *P < 0.05 compared with control (3 mM glucose without extract).
